Revolutionize Your Business With A Spend Management System

In today’s fast-paced business environment, the ability to effectively manage spending is crucial to success. Companies are constantly looking for ways to cut costs, improve efficiency, and optimize their financial processes. This is where a spend management system comes into play.

A spend management system is a software solution that helps organizations track, control, and optimize their expenses. It allows businesses to automate processes, streamline workflows, and gain valuable insights into their spending habits. By implementing a spend management system, companies can take control of their costs, reduce waste, and improve their bottom line.

One of the key benefits of a spend management system is its ability to centralize all spending data in one place. This allows businesses to easily track and monitor their expenses, regardless of where they are incurred. By having a single source of truth for all spending information, companies can make more informed decisions and identify areas where costs can be reduced.

Another advantage of a spend management system is its ability to automate manual processes. For example, instead of relying on paper-based expense reports or invoices, businesses can use the system to digitize these workflows. This not only saves time and reduces errors but also allows for faster processing and approval of expenses.

Furthermore, a spend management system can help companies identify areas of overspending or waste. By analyzing spending patterns and trends, organizations can pinpoint areas where costs can be reduced or eliminated. This can lead to significant savings and improve the overall financial health of the business.

In addition, a spend management system can provide valuable insights into vendor relationships and contract management. By tracking vendor performance and compliance, businesses can ensure they are getting the best value for their money. They can also identify opportunities to negotiate better terms or switch to more cost-effective suppliers.
